Hi all,

Another probably daft question ..... but first .... many thanks to all you more experienced Bongo owners, this forum is hugely useful.

Here goes; we have noticed (it's not hard to miss) a quite strong 'motor noise/vibration/throbbing' (yes I did use the word 'throbbing') starting up when the engine is running. The revs seem to drop a small amount but we still have full power. This often happens when we come to a stop at a roundabout or T-junction.

Also, sometimes when we have come to a stop and turned the ignition off and then back on, perhaps to put up an electric window, this motor noise (not the engine starting) will start up again.

It all feels like it's coming from directly below the drivers seat.

If anyone can make any sense of this ...... well done and again .... I apologise for my mechanical ignorance if this is something blindingly obvious. I'm on a very steep learning curve here ;)

Thanks in advance for your suggestions and help.

Tony.

The cooling fans for the Air con radiator come to mind ? Have you tried turning the Air Con ON/OFF to see if that is what you are hearing ? This would be coupled with the Air Con compressor being switched on/off and this will affect the engine speed as the rev's are turned up slightly when its operating.

Otherwise there is the Scavenger fan, but this normally only operates when the engine housing gets hot, if that is coming on/off it might be down to a fault with its sensor.

When the air-con kicks in it has a significant clunk and a drain on the revs when idling. quite normal really but not so noticeable when popping along the road
